Jean-Aimé Toupane (coach of France, winner of Australia 70-57): “It was a very tough match which rewards the long road traveled since August (beginning of preparation, editor's note).
The team really behaved as a team, showed character.
The girls fought.
We didn't know it wouldn't be easy against Australia at home."
Gabby Williams (France winger, top scorer of the match): “We showed a lot of maturity, despite the many absences.
We are a young team.
I used the energy of my teammates, everyone contributed to the victory.
This is a very good sign for the future.
Australia at home, with the return of Lauren Jackson (retired Australian and world basketball star, editor's note), we knew that a lot of things would be against us.
We wanted to have fun.
This morning (Thursday), we said to ourselves: no matter what happens, let's stay united.
I am proud and pleasantly surprised.”
